    Pittsburgh (AP) – Pittsburgh Steelers Star Star, TJ Watt, jumped the start of the mini -cap compulsory on Tuesday, sending a message not so subtle to the only team for which he ever played for his desire to return a new contract before the start of next season.

    The quadruple defensive player of the year All-Pro and 2021 AP NFL is about to enter the last season of the four-year extension that he signed in September 2021. The $ 112 million pact made Watt the best paid defender of the League at the time.

    This number has been overshadowed several times in the past four years, notably by the star of Cleveland Myles Garrett, who signed an agreement in March which made him the most well-composed quarter of the League at $ 40 million per season.

    “We would certainly like to be here, but certainly not surprised where we are,” said Pittsburgh coach Mike Tomlin. “We have expressed the desire to do the business, he also has it, and we will therefore continue to work. We have already been here. ”

    The decision to skip the mini-camp is a change compared to the approach of Watt in 2021, when it did a “maintenance” during the mini-camp and the training camp before designing a contract on the eve of the regular season.

    Tomlin said he was not concerned about Watt’s long-term future in Pittsburgh and refused to comment if Watt gave the organization a warning that he would remain at home in Wisconsin rather than joining the 89 other players on the list, including the recently signed quarter-rear.

    Watt equaled an NFL record by obtaining 22 1/2 bags after having signed its current extension. He again directed the league in bags in 2023, although this number increased to 11 1/2 last season, the least Watt in a year in which he did not miss extended time because of an injury since he was recruited in 2017.

    The defensive coordinator Teryl Austin thinks that the absence of Watt will offer opportunities to young players such as the third year outside second year Nick Herbig and the recruit Jack Sawyer.

    Maybe, but no more the CV changing the situation of Watt. Watt, which will be 31 years old in October, is the defense gable that helped the Steelers contain despite the heavy unsubscription rate in the quarter since the retirement of Ben Roethlisberger in January 2022.

    Rodgers will have his chance after accepting a one -year contract last week. The quadruple MVP of the NFL has undergone individual exercises but has spent most of the session to chat with its new teammates and follow a game sheet.
